What is Flow UX Design?

Creating a seamless journey from start to finish is what flow UX design is all about. It’s the art of crafting intuitive pathways that guide users through a digital experience without friction or confusion. In an era where user-centric design is paramount, understanding flow’s role in UX can significantly impact user engagement and satisfaction.

Understanding Flow in UX Design

The Concept of Flow

Flow, at its core, is a state of immersion where users become deeply engaged in an activity. In the context of UX design, it’s about guiding users through an experience so naturally that they forget they’re even interacting with a design. This concept is grounded in psychology, highlighting how immersive experiences enhance user satisfaction.

Importance of Flow

Why does flow matter so much? It’s essential because it ensures that users can achieve their goals effortlessly. Key Principles of Flow UX Design

Clarity and Simplicity

Think of your design as a map. If the map is cluttered and confusing, users will get lost. Clear navigation and simple design elements are crucial for maintaining flow. When users can intuitively find their way, they stay focused and engaged.

Consistency

Consistency in design is akin to setting a rhythm in music. It ensures that users know what to expect, reducing cognitive load and promoting a smoother experience. Consistent design elements, such as color schemes and typography, help users feel comfortable and confident as they navigate.

Feedback Mechanisms

Imagine cooking without tasting the food. Feedback provides users with the assurance that their actions are effective. Whether it’s a simple animation or a sound cue, feedback confirms that the user is on the right track, enhancing confidence and flow.

Strategies to Achieve Flow in UX Design

User Research and Testing

Understanding your users is like knowing your audience before a performance. Through user research and testing, designers can tailor experiences that resonate with their audience’s needs and preferences. This insight is vital for creating a flow that keeps users coming back.

Prototyping and Iteration

Design is not a one-shot deal; it’s more like sculpting. Prototyping and iterating allow designers to refine their creations continually. By testing and refining, designers can enhance flow, ensuring a smooth and engaging user experience.
